Disc versions of the game do not mean that you will be able to play the game if/when the servers are shut down.
<@&630898404481826887> Yes it would. You would still be able to play against AI. And then could look at the tanks in my garage.
Most online only games dont work that way. This game like amny require an online connection, the game checks for an online connection when you boot it up. If you cant get that connection the game will never get past is inital boot menu. It being on a disc doesnt really matter as the console is just reading the information stored on a disk which is practically no different than it being stored on a hard drive or SSD.
